You won't be lost out there and all alone for much longer—Fuller House season two is near. The Tanners return on Friday, Dec. 9 with a new batch of episodes on Netflix, many with a holiday theme. But that's not the only change for the new season of Fuller House. Candace Cameron Bure, Jodie Sweetin and Andrea Barber and their brood are still the focus, but you can expect many faces from the past to show up once again.

This is everything we know about Fuller House season two.

Home for the Holidays
Unlike last season, Fuller House season two will feature several Tanner family holiday celebrations, including, but not limited to: Thanksgiving, Christmas and Halloween. Just when you thought things couldn't get anymore wholesome…

Returning Faces
All the Full House veterans who appeared in season one will return for season two in the same recurring capacity. That means you'll see Bob Saget, John Stamos, Lori Loughlin, Dave Coulier and Blake and Dylan Tuomy-Wilhoit.

Additionally, you'll be seeing a lot more of Ashley Liao as Lola, John Brotherton as Matt, Juan Pablo Di Pace as Fernando and Scott Weinger as Steve.

New Returning Faces
Marla Sokoloff will reprise her Full House role of Gia in the new season of Fuller House. A friend of Stephanie's, Gia started out as an enemy for the middle Tanner child. Gia initially had a bad influence on Stephanie, but the two balanced each other out in the end.
 
New Faces on Returning Faces
No, not talking about plastic surgery here. However, when D.J. comes face-to-face with her ex-beau Nelson at her high school reunion he'll be played by a different actor. Hal Sparks is taking over the role from Jason Marsden.

Truly New Faces
Viewers will meet another Gibbler. Switched at Birth star Adam Hagenbuch will join the series as Jimmy, Kimmy's brother. Jimmy is described the male version of Kimmy. No word on whether Garth, her older brother who was only mentioned in the original series, never seen, will appear. And the trailer shows Jimmy and Stephanie K-I-S-S-I-N-G.

Viewers will also meet Joey Gladstone's wife and kids. Laura Bell Bundy will play Joey's wife.

New Kids on the Block
No, we don't mean there will be new kids on the block, but actually New Kids on the Block. The nostalgia is real when the boy band appears in an episode. Just look how excited Kimmy and Stephanie are.

No Olsen Twins—Still
Yes, Michelle Tanner will be absent from all family gatherings once again. Mary-Kate Olsen and Ashley Olsen have not reversed their stance and Elizabeth Olsen didn't sign on toe play a role made famous by her sisters. But you can expect more cheeky comments like last season.

Fuller House season 2 premieres Friday, Dec. 9 on Netflix.
